To provide an Apprenticeship to somebody who is looking to gain experience within a financial environment specifically within Social Care and explicitly centred around means testing a client’s ability to pay towards their care. In addition to gaining valuable experience of working in a busy financial environment, you will also be supported in studying for a National Vocational Business Administration Qualification, starting level dependant on skills and experience.
